Trait deferred_reference::SlicePointerIndex [−][src]
A helper trait used for indexing operations, which is modeled after the SliceIndex trait from the Rust core library, but which promises not to take a reference to the underlying slice.
Safety
Implementations of this trait have to promise that:
- If the argument to get_(mut_)unchecked is a safe pointer, then so is the result.
- The pointers may not be dereferenced (both pointers given as arguments as well as the returned pointers).

fn get(self, slice: *const T) -> Option<*const Self::Output>
[src]
Returns a shared pointer to the output at this location, if in bounds.
fn get_mut(self, slice: *mut T) -> Option<*mut Self::Output>
[src]
Returns a mutable poiner to the output at this location, if in bounds.
unsafe fn get_unchecked(self, slice: *const T) -> *const Self::Output
[src]
Returns a shared pointer to the output at this location, without
performing any bounds checking.
Calling this method with an out-of-bounds index or a dangling slice
pointer
is undefined behavior even if the resulting reference is not used.
unsafe fn get_unchecked_mut(self, slice: *mut T) -> *mut Self::Output
[src]
Returns a mutable pointer to the output at this location, without
performing any bounds checking.
Calling this method with an out-of-bounds index or a dangling slice
pointer
is undefined behavior even if the resulting reference is not used.
fn index(self, slice: *const T) -> *const Self::Output
[src]
Returns a shared pointer to the output at this location, panicking if out of bounds.
fn index_mut(self, slice: *mut T) -> *mut Self::Output
[src]
Returns a mutable pointer to the output at this location, panicking if out of bounds.
